在移动端使用TP钱包时出现闪退,往往不是单一原因,而是“客户端状态异常—网络/节点异常—权限与组件冲突—安全防护触发—链上交互异常”等多因素叠加。下面给出一套全方位的排查与修复思路,同时结合“防APT攻击、信息化社会发展、行业透视剖析、高科技生态系统、轻客户端、以太坊”等视角,帮助你既解决问题,也提升安全韧性。
一、先做快速止血:排查闪退的最常见触发点
1)重启与清理缓存
- 彻底退出TP钱包(从后台滑掉),重启手机。

- 进入系统设置-应用管理-Tp钱包-存储,清理缓存(谨慎清理数据:会影响钱包本地缓存与部分设置)。
- 若仍异常,重装前先确认你已备份助记词/私钥(仅作安全提醒:任何修复都以“资产可恢复”为前提)。
2)升级到最新版本
- 闪退经常与旧版本兼容性、依赖库更新、链上接口变更有关。
- 同时检查:手机系统版本是否过旧或刚升级导致兼容性问题。
3)检查网络环境
- 切换网络:Wi-Fi ↔ 移动数据。
- 关闭/重启代理、加速器、企业VPN、DNS劫持。
- 若你常在弱网环境使用,可能触发RPC/鉴权超时或UI线程阻塞,引发崩溃。
4)定位是否“特定页面触发”
- 观察:是打开即闪退?进入钱包资产页闪退?点转账/签名闪退?
- 如果只有某个功能页异常,优先排查该页面涉及的链交互(例如以太坊的签名、代币查询、Gas估算)。
二、深入排查:从“轻客户端”到“以太坊交互”的链上触发原因
TP钱包属于轻客户端/轻交互模式思路:它不一定完整验证所有状态,但会依赖节点/RPC服务与本地组件完成查询、签名、广播。闪退常见于以下链路:
1)以太坊RPC/节点问题
- 现象:切换网络后仍能打开,但查余额、代币列表、历史记录或发起交易时闪退。
- 处理:
- 尝试更换RPC配置(若TP提供自定义RPC入口)。
- 观察是否是某个链(以太坊主网/某条L2)特有问题。
- 等待区块链网关恢复:有时是节点暂时不可用导致异常处理缺陷。
2)Gas估算/合约调用返回异常
- 以太坊转账、兑换、代币交互往往依赖Gas估算和合约调用返回数据。
- 若合约返回结构与客户端预期不一致,或遇到大幅波动导致估算接口超时,可能触发崩溃。
- 建议:
- 暂时关闭“自动估算/自动刷新”等高频动作(如有设置)。
- 改用低频操作:先在浏览器/其他工具确认合约与代币是否异常,再在TP里执行。
3)代币列表/资产渲染异常
- 某些代币的元数据(logo、decimals、symbol、合约交互方式)可能造成渲染或解析错误。
- 处理:
- 暂时减少代币展示(如支持隐藏可疑代币)。
- 更新后再同步资产;或先清缓存再重载。
三、系统层与权限/组件冲突:高概率工程原因
1)权限与加密组件
- 钱包会调用系统加密能力、键盘/剪贴板、通知栏、文件读写等。
- 若开启了“省电模式”“后台限制”“安全加固”类应用,可能拦截导致闪退。
- 处理:
- 在手机设置中给予必要权限(存储/剪贴板/网络/后台运行等)。
- 关闭与TP钱包强冲突的省电/安全插件(如有“应用保护/隐私防护”)。
2)第三方应用注入
- 近期装的安全软件、自动化脚本、框架类工具(如改包、注入、内存加固)可能导致运行时崩溃。
- 处理:卸载或暂禁这些应用/模块后验证。
3)系统语言/编码或输入法异常
- 部分机型在输入某些地址/备注时触发异常。
- 处理:更换输入法、清空输入框再重试。
四、从“防APT攻击”视角加强安全,减少“恶意触发闪退”
APT(高级持续性威胁)不只是窃取密钥,也可能通过诱导用户签名、投放恶意网页、或利用客户端异常处理来实现拒绝服务/会话劫持。
1)警惕可疑链接与DApp
- 轻客户端通常会依赖远端服务进行交互与呈现。
- 风险:钓鱼DApp、恶意合约调用、异常交易参数。
- 建议:
- 不在不明来源页面授权或签名。
- 交易前逐项核对:合约地址、接收方、金额单位(ETH vs token decimals)、Gas上限。
2)签名信息验证与最小授权
- 不要“一键放行所有权限”。
- 如果需要授权ERC-20,尽量选择“仅授权必要额度”,并定期检查授权记录。
3)本地环境加固
- 使用系统自带的安全更新,避免长时间停留在高风险系统版本。
- 若设备被root/jailbreak或装有注入/抓包工具,谨慎使用真实资产账户。
4)异常触发时的处置原则
- 一旦发现“打开即闪退”“签名前突然崩溃”“广播失败但却弹出奇怪提示”等情况:
- 先停止操作,不要重复签名。
- 切换网络、重启并确认是否仍是同一DApp/同一链路触发。
- 从官方渠道更新与核验配置。
五、行业透视与高科技生态系统:为什么“轻客户端”更要严谨

在信息化社会与高科技生态系统中,轻客户端的优势在于:更轻量、更便捷、更易使用。但它也把更多可靠性与安全性压力转移到:
- 节点/RPC供应链
- 传输层安全(TLS/证书校验、反劫持)
- 远端元数据(代币列表、图标、合约ABI/解析)
- 客户端异常处理鲁棒性
因此,修复闪退不仅是“让程序不崩”,还要追求:
- 稳定性:避免异常输入/异常响应导致崩溃。
- 安全性:避免被恶意数据触发逻辑漏洞。
- 可观测性:能采集日志并定位链路错误。
六、以太坊专项建议:减少闪退与交易失败的实操清单
1)交易前核对
- 地址校验:收款地址与合约地址无误。
- 单位校验:ETH(18 decimals)与代币(不同decimals)。
- Gas策略:网络拥堵时避免过低Gas上限。
2)切换网络/链路
- 如果以太坊主网交互不稳定,尝试切换RPC或确认L2通道是否正常。
3)先用小额测试
- 在确认安全前,不要直接做大额操作。
七、仍无法解决:提交日志与官方支持的正确姿势
如果上述步骤仍无效,建议:
- 记录闪退发生场景:打开即闪退/某页面/某功能。
- 记录手机型号、系统版本、TP钱包版本号、网络环境、涉及的链(以太坊/其他)。
- 尽可能保留操作前后的日志(若TP提供日志导出/崩溃报告)。
- 联系官方客服或社区支持,提供上述信息,以便工程团队定位是否为已知兼容性问题或某类链路异常。
结语
TP钱包闪退的修复,既需要工程排查(缓存、版本、网络、权限、输入与渲染),也需要安全治理(防APT、警惕恶意DApp、最小授权与异常处置)。在以太坊生态下,轻客户端的稳定与安全很大程度取决于节点交互、合约数据解析与健壮的异常处理。按本文的“先止血—再定位链路—再强化安全—最后求助日志”的路径,你通常能更快恢复稳定使用,并降低未来同类风险。
评论
MoonFox
按你的思路先清缓存+换网络,再定位到转账页崩溃,基本就能锁定是链上交互那块的问题。
小竹林
防APT那段很有用,尤其是授权最小额度和交易逐项核对,能直接减少被恶意DApp诱导的概率。
CipherNova
“轻客户端”视角讲得清楚:节点/RPC、代币元数据解析这些才是高频雷点。
AsterChen
我也是以太坊主网查询代币列表时闪退,更新版本后+换RPC就好了,和你分析一致。
EchoWaves
建议补一句:遇到签名前突然崩溃就别反复点签,先停手排查,这个很关键。